Basic Information

Product Name 3-Fluoro-n-Phenylbenzamide
CAS No. 1629-09-0
Molecular Formula C₁₃H₁₀FNO
Molecular Weight 215.22 g/mol
Synonyms 3-Fluoro-N-phenylbenzamide; N-Phenyl-3-fluorobenzamide; 3-Fluorobenzoic Acid Phenylamide; m-Fluoro-N-phenylbenzamide; Benzanilide, 3'-fluoro-; 3-Fluorobenzanilide; 3-Fluoro-N-phenyl-benzamide; 1629-09-0
